Part Description
The ModCap UHP series capacitors are engineered to withstand continuous operation at temperatures up to +105 °C without derating. With a voltage rating ranging from 1350V to 1800V and a capacitance range of 470µF to 880µF, these capacitors are optimized for high-frequency performance, particularly in SiC semiconductor-based inverters. Their modular design and high current density not only enhance performance but also extend the operational lifetime to an impressive 200,000 hours at +105 °C. The capacitors feature a very low equivalent series inductance (ESL) of 8 nH, making them suitable for fast-switching applications.
